Renewable energy is a possibility for Namibia, solar energy to be specific. Herald Share's his concerns for the daily electricity consumer in Namibia and explains how they could save a lot more money individually and as a nation if Namibia adds solar energy as a source of energy for the country. The way he see's it, why burn so much coal?

Mr Schutt is a passionate net worker and prominent in addressing developmental issues within Namibia. His proactive approach to facilitating change through innovative business practices allows him to engage with various industry stakeholders given the opportunity. He owes this ability to his training and experience as a teacher.
